The Look
This buckle features the portrait of Chief Red Wolf, die-struck from the original Bohlin die in sterling silver, set above crossed arrows. The composition reflects Bohlin’s early Western work, with a strong central figure balanced by traditional symbolic elements.
Each piece is fabricated by hand using traditional Bohlin techniques, with individually formed components and hand-finished detail. Designed for durability and long-term wear, it carries forward a standard of craftsmanship established over a century ago.

Care
Bohlin buckles are made to be worn, not just displayed. Crafted from solid precious metals with hand-finished details, each piece is intended to develop a natural patina over time — a signature of heirloom-quality silver and gold.
To clean, gently wipe with a soft, non-abrasive cloth and, if needed, use mild diluted soap and warm water to remove surface dirt. Rinse thoroughly and dry completely before storing.
Avoid chemical polishes or ultrasonic cleaners, as they can damage intentional finishes, inlays, and natural oxidation. Patina is part of the story — let it evolve with you.
